Responsibilities
- Ability to lead /collaborate and build and maintain strong relationships with key partners from across company’s Securities (Sales & Trading, Accounting, Technology, and other key groups).
- Perform regular / routine processing functions such as month end procedures, account reconciliations, projections, running queries and reports, variance analysis, suspense and error resolution and set-up/maintenance of transactions / entries where applicable.
- Update Funding and paydown request and process SWIFT payments – MT 202, 103
- Manual generation of monthly Invoices
- Conduct standard reporting and analysis as directed
- Provides specialized analysis / administration, processing and verification or reconciliation support as assigned
- Provide reporting to rating agencies like DBRS
- Forecast and raise daily funding requests
- Demonstrate an innovative and can-do approach while building and cultivating an environment of innovation and participating in department projects to stream line our processes.
- Oversees resolution of issues and risks effectively and understands when to inform senior management.
- Deep understanding of operational risk management to effectively identify issues and dependencies and evaluate and enhance controls while keeping well informed of emerging issues, trends, and evolving regulatory requirements and assess potential impacts.
